Autor Thema: Datumsfelder  (Gelesen 1723 mal)

Offline fiuman007

  • Aktives Mitglied
  • ***
  • Beiträge: 134
  • Geschlecht: Männlich
  • flumensis hypatia
Datumsfelder
« am: 10.08.05 - 15:10:40 »
Hallo zusammen,

ich stehe vor einem Problem:
Ich habe ein Start und ein Enddatum.
Wenn die die Erfassungsmaske aufrufe soll im StartDatumsFeld das heutige Datum stehen. Kein Problem, mit @Today. Das EndDatumsFeld ist erstmal leer. 
Dann wenn ich ein einderes Startdatum über den Kalender eingebe, soll dasselbe Datum auch im EndDatumsFeld erscheinen.  Wie soll ich das machen ?
Edit: nachfolgend soll das EndDatumsFeld manuell editierbar sein.... (über den Kalender)


Das ganze läuft im Web und ist im JavaScript eingebettet....

Vielen Dank
fiuman007
fluminensis hypatia

Offline Mandalor

  • Senior Mitglied
  • ****
  • Beiträge: 359
  • Geschlecht: Männlich
Re: Datumsfelder
« Antwort #1 am: 10.08.05 - 15:29:52 »
im exiting event des Startdatumsfeld kannst du Field enddatum := Startdatum setzen
mit besten Grüßen

Markus Petzold

Offline robertpp

  • Gold Platin u.s.w. member:)
  • *****
  • Beiträge: 940
  • Geschlecht: Männlich
Re: Datumsfelder
« Antwort #2 am: 10.08.05 - 15:48:38 »
Ich würde das ganze mit einem temporären Datum machen und auch nur dann wenn die Maske gespeichert wird.

@If(tempDate != StartDatum;@SetField("EndDatum";StartDatum;"")
und das tempDate wird beim öffnen des doc's gesetzt.
------------------------------------------------------------
1250 Notes User Client von 5.0.5 bis 6.5.4     WIN2000, XP
14 Notes Server von 6.5 bis 6.5.4 WIN2000, XP

32   Notes Server von 5.0.1 bis 6.5.4 in unserer Domain
323 Notes Server weltweit mit 38000 User in einem Adressbuch

Offline fiuman007

  • Aktives Mitglied
  • ***
  • Beiträge: 134
  • Geschlecht: Männlich
  • flumensis hypatia
Re: Datumsfelder
« Antwort #3 am: 10.08.05 - 16:03:20 »
Hm, na ja. Ganz so geht es nicht.

Es ist folgendes. Das StartDatum wird auch gleich geändert (also beim Erfassen) d.h. ich muss nicht das Dokument vorher abspeichern. Wenn ich dann das startDatum ändere soll derselbe Wert auch in den EndDatum reingeschrieben werden. Also irgendwie onChange ...
Aber wie ....
fluminensis hypatia

Offline Mandalor

  • Senior Mitglied
  • ****
  • Beiträge: 359
  • Geschlecht: Männlich
Re: Datumsfelder
« Antwort #4 am: 10.08.05 - 16:15:50 »
MACH ES DOCH IM  exiting event!!!

Das wird ausgeführt, wenn das feld verlassen wird

Edit: OK ich sehe gerade, in dem event musst du es mit LS machen
« Letzte Änderung: 10.08.05 - 16:17:43 von Mandalor »
mit besten Grüßen

Markus Petzold

Offline fiuman007

  • Aktives Mitglied
  • ***
  • Beiträge: 134
  • Geschlecht: Männlich
  • flumensis hypatia
Re: Datumsfelder
« Antwort #5 am: 10.08.05 - 16:22:28 »
Hm, und mit LS kenn ich mich überhaupt nicht aus.
So jedenfalls funktioniert es nicht :

Sub Exiting(Source As Field)
   datEnd = datStart
End Sub




:(
fluminensis hypatia

Offline koehlerbv

  • Moderator
  • Gold Platin u.s.w. member:)
  • *****
  • Beiträge: 20.460
  • Geschlecht: Männlich
Re: Datumsfelder
« Antwort #6 am: 10.08.05 - 17:06:16 »
Markus, hast Du eigentlich gelesen, dass es hier um eine Web-Anwendung geht ?

Bernhard

 

Impressum Atnotes.de  -  Powered by Syslords Solutions  -  Datenschutz